No description
Find a file
Viktor Barzin 5a6b20c8f1
fix: resolve 13 important issues from code review
I1: Add graceful shutdown (SIGTERM/SIGINT) to all 5 background services
I2: Fix Dockerfile healthcheck to use curl on /metrics endpoint
I3: Fix StreamConsumer.ensure_group() to only catch BUSYGROUP errors
I4: Fix SimulatedBroker to reject orders with insufficient cash/shares
I5: Move ORM attribute access inside DB session context in trades routes
I6: Add Redis-based rate limiting (10 req/min/IP) on all auth endpoints
I8: Prevent backtest background task garbage collection
I9: Use Numeric(16,6) instead of Float for financial columns in migration
I10: Add index on trades.created_at for time-range queries
I11: Bind infrastructure ports to 127.0.0.1 in docker-compose
I12: Add migrations init service; all app services depend on it
I13: Fix user enumeration in login_begin (return options for non-existent users)
2026-02-22 17:58:01 +00:00
.claude Add project knowledge file for Claude Code sessions 2026-02-22 17:25:27 +00:00
alembic fix: resolve 13 important issues from code review 2026-02-22 17:58:01 +00:00
backtester fix: resolve 13 important issues from code review 2026-02-22 17:58:01 +00:00
dashboard feat: dashboard trading views -- portfolio, trades, strategies, news, backtest 2026-02-22 15:54:44 +00:00
docker fix: resolve 13 important issues from code review 2026-02-22 17:58:01 +00:00
docs/plans Add sprint plan — 6 sprints with goals and acceptance criteria 2026-02-22 15:08:17 +00:00
scripts feat: integration tests, seed data, and smoke test script 2026-02-22 16:02:44 +00:00
services fix: resolve 13 important issues from code review 2026-02-22 17:58:01 +00:00
shared fix: resolve 13 important issues from code review 2026-02-22 17:58:01 +00:00
tests feat: integration tests, seed data, and smoke test script 2026-02-22 16:02:44 +00:00
.env.example fix: resolve 8 critical issues from code review 2026-02-22 17:48:40 +00:00
.gitignore feat: docker compose infrastructure — postgres+timescaledb, redis, ollama 2026-02-22 15:11:50 +00:00
alembic.ini feat: database models and alembic migrations — all tables per design 2026-02-22 15:17:07 +00:00
docker-compose.yml fix: resolve 13 important issues from code review 2026-02-22 17:58:01 +00:00
pyproject.toml feat: integration tests, seed data, and smoke test script 2026-02-22 16:02:44 +00:00